The Fair
Luke Breen 1998 (United States)
Who wouldn’t love the fair
With the clowns, and their big red hair
They’re not here to scare
It’s not like They’re a bear
Leading you to their lair
It just a trip to the fair
And I have no care
For thoughts to scare
In my head
I must put to bed
With clowns and funny faces
While I run to different places
Seeing men holding different cases
I wonder what kinda place this is
Not seeing a familiar face
During a chase
Firmly gripping my mace
As I trip over my shoelaces
Falling onto my face
Making a man lose his case
As we clench into a romantic embrace
It was my man
Dressed in a can
Smelling of expired spam
I had come to deliver his lamb
I had cooked last night
After our fight
We felt so light
And he looked so bright
Not dressed in red hair
With no care
We retreated into his lair
As I lay on his chest hair
Until he left to the fair
As I sat on the chair
With a blank stare
